30-10-2021 0183 32 Particle size Distribution D10 is also written as X10, D 0,1 or X 0,1 It represents the particle diameter corresponding to 10 cumulative from 0 to 100 undersize particle size distribution In other words, if particle size D10 is 78um, we can say 10 of the particles in the tested sample are smaller than 78 micrometer, or the percentage of particles smaller than ,...

A particle size distribution can be represented in different ways with respect to the weighting of individual particl The weighting mechanism will depend upon the measuring principle being used Number weighted distributions A counting technique such as image analysis will give a number weighted...

The particle size distribution can be presented graphically as histograms as shown in Fig 718b or as cumulative curves, usually on log-probability plots Fig 91 Alternatively, the distribution may be characterized by parameters such as mean particle size, median particle size, sorting, skewness, and kurtosis, which...
